And I think this is really probably the bigger bottleneck for actual adoption in personal and even more importantly, kind of work environments.
And I think one of the areas where, I mean, to bring it back to what we're working on, where I think is limitation, it's...
like there's kind of both sides are a little bit scared of of allowing this to happen so like i'm as a user scared of like allowing access to all of my data 100 and then the company is actually on the other side also a little bit scared of like getting all of the user data and be responsible for you know something goes wrong and so that's true and who knows what it is yeah
Yeah, like, again, you know, there's a HIPAA compliance, right?
If you're taking on medical data, like, for example, all of the AI companies now, people uploading their medical data there, and they're not HIPAA compliant.
So this is like a big question there, right?
Obviously, you know, all the other kind of challenges.
And, you know, when we go to companies, it's even more like the IP rights and all of those things.
And so this is where I think confidentiality privacy is really important because this would actually unlock ability to get a lot more context into these models and really enable them to be kind of more in a driver's seat and help with things.

Like your emails, your calendar, your companies, you know, documents, you know, potentially like private IP, private medical data.
Like, I mean, imagine what you can do now if you just run like the AI model, like GPT-5 is actually really good at health data, right?
Like it may be better than some, you know, a big percentage of doctors now at things, but it doesn't have access to all the medical data, right?
And you don't want that data to leave where it is sitting right now.
So ideally, you bring the model to the data.
